    Composite AV Wire

    This is the first set of AV cables that hit the market. It has become less popular in recent times due to not being able to transmit HD signals. However, they can still be used on DVD players, cable boxes and gaming consoles.

    S-Video AV Wire

    With this cable, video signals can be divided or categorized into two sections. As compared to composite mentioned above, the images or picture quality is of higher quality.
